Vic or Dick Woinarski as he was more commonly known as played reserve grade football for Carlton in 1952.

Woinarski was a key position defender recruited from the bayside club Seaford.
A centre half back, The Herald said 18yo Victor was signed to Carlton in 1950. (Trove: Herald October 05 p24 1950)

Woinarski was cleared to VFA club Oakleigh in April 1954.

He didn't manage to play a senior game for Carlton.

His brother Brian Woinarski a 20yo wingman from Seaford was signed to St.Kilda (Herald October 16 1950 p13)
